Abstract: The area of sustainability has begun to receive increasing attention in management education. New ways of including the topic of sustainability in higher education are being discussed. Nonetheless, the question how can we do this? remains. The objective of this paper is to explore ways of integrating the topic of sustainability into different undergraduate management courses. Documentary analysis and action research were used as methods and data were analysed using content analysis. First, the plan of all the courses was analysed to map the contents, which were more directly related to sustainability. Next, one course from each field (Finance, Marketing, Public Administration, Production and Systems, Human Resources) was selected and professors were contacted. Finally, we prepared and led a class dealing with issues related to sustainability. Results show that there are concrete ways to integrate management education and sustainability and to change the traditional teaching pattern.
